ABOUT YOUR NITTO PORTABLE
MAGNETIC DRILLING MACHINE
●
Do not use the power supply for the engine
powered welder.
●
Do not operate on the ceiling.
The tool should be
operated on a horizontal place or the wall (vertically).
Do not operate the tool on the ceiling (upside down).
(Fig. 1) Never use this unit at the work on ceiling
(upside down).

●
Minimum workpiece thickness of 6mm.
If a
workpiece is not thick enough, it will weaken the
magnetism, preventing proper operation due to
the slipping or lifting from the workpiece. When
drilling a workpiece of insufficient thickness, it is
recommended that a piece of iron, approximately
7mm thick and somewhat larger in size than that of
the Magnet, be placed on the reverse side of the
workpiece.
(Fig. 2, Fig. 3)
Not less than 6mm
(Fig. 2)
less than 6mm
Place 7mm or more
thick piece iron
(Fig. 3)

Use appropriate machine for the intended work.
Do not use small machine and attachments for work
to be handled by large machine. It may cause injury.
●
Handle the battery charger cord gently.
Do not carry the battery charger with the cord or do
not unplug from the electric outlet by pulling the cord.
Avoid damaging the cord by fabricating, excessive
bending, placing close to high temperature area,
pulling, twisting, bundling, placing heavy weight on
it, inserting between objects, hooking on a metal
part, etc.

●
Use the genuine battery pack of Nitto.
Safety and warrantee for the product is not
guaranteed when a battery pack not specified
by Nitto or a battery pack that was disassembled
or modified (includes battery packs that were
disassembled and internal parts such as cells were
replaced) is used.
●
Immediately remove the battery pack from the
device or battery charger and avoid using it when
abnormal smell at use, charging or storage is
identified or when heat generation, discoloration,
deformation or other conditions different from
conventional condition is observed.

●
Request for repair of cordless machines to
specialized stores.
Do not disassemble, repair or modify the machine,
battery charger or battery pack.
Request for inspection and repair when heat
generation or any abnormality is observed with the
machine, battery charger or battery pack.
Request for repair to the sales agent where the
product was purchased or your nearest authorized
Nitto dealer. Repairing by yourself may cause an
accident or injury.
